Choosing the Right Bulb

When selecting a bulb for your Fluker’s clamp lamp setup, it’s crucial to consider the specific lighting requirements of your reptile. Most reptiles require a combination of heat and UVB light. For heat, you can opt for incandescent bulbs, while UVB bulbs are essential for reptiles that need exposure to ultraviolet light for vitamin D synthesis. It’s important to choose bulbs that are appropriate for your reptile’s species and size.

Tips for Using Fluker’s Clamp Lamp Setup

Here are some handy tips to maximize the benefits of Fluker’s clamp lamp setup:

1. Proper Distance

Ensure the lamp is positioned at the recommended distance from your reptile’s basking spot. This distance varies depending on the reptile species and the wattage of the bulb. Research the specific requirements for your pet to avoid any potential harm.

2. Heat Gradient

Create a heat gradient within the enclosure by positioning the lamp at one end. This allows your reptile to regulate its body temperature by moving closer or further away from the lamp as needed.

3. Bulb Replacement

Regularly check and replace bulbs as needed. Over time, the intensity of UVB and heat output diminishes, so it’s crucial to provide your reptile with fresh and effective lighting.

4. Photoperiod

Reptiles require a proper photoperiod, mimicking their natural day and night cycle. Use a timer to ensure consistent and regular lighting, promoting a healthy routine for your pet.
